Output d7226fa6a79c150583574eb37f30219b1199346bd07f713c38a4030525b0cfe6:1

value
8570400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e3a3bb947dbedb78e8f15ba50e2c29a26f4a9fb OP_EQUAL
address
3Bjr1mMApT1qfNZMu3UV5xSTSfkQGAw3rZ
transaction
d7226fa6a79c150583574eb37f30219b1199346bd07f713c38a4030525b0cfe6
confirmations
342739
spent
true